Some governments really understand the socio-economic value of our industry and work hard in partnership, and others could learn some lessons from them.” BVC: How does data drive your efforts and is CHTA working on any environmental sustainability initiatives? Comito: “We do some of our own primary data collection but most of the data we gather is secondary. The Caribbean Tourism Organization (CTO) collects a lot of data on visitor arrivals to the region, so we draw on that. One of our strategic partners is STR (Smith Travel Research) and they are the top global company on measuring hotel performance and hotel developments throughout the world. We encourage our members to participate in the STR reporting programs and offer incentives for them to do that. We also do our own annual economic performance and outlook study in January. That gives us a reading on where the industry is at, what are the challenges, how it performed in terms of employment, capital expenditure spending, sales, and other barometers. We have several other data partners like the World Travel and Tourism Council and MasterCard who provide great insights on traveler behaviors and the industry’s impact. “On the environmental sustainability front, through our Caribbean Alliance for Sustainable Tourism, we just offered a webinar for our members on use of plastics and the alternatives, and best practices on how some people are approaching it.
